
This dataset provides a data catalogue of axle-box accelerations with corresponding vehicle speed and travelled distance profiles measured on in-service light rail vehicles for rail infrastructure condition monitoring. This data set was created and published within the mFUND project OnboardEU. OnboardEU (grant 01F2192A) was funded as part of the mFUND innovation initiative of the Federal Ministry for Digital and Transport, Germany (Bundesministerium für Digitales und Verkehr, BMDV). As part of the mFUND funding programme, the BMDV has been supporting research and development projects relating to data-based digital innovations for Mobility 4.0 since 2016. The project funding is supplemented by active professional networking between stakeholders from politics, business, administration and research and the provision of open data on the Mobilithek.
